  • Brazil’s unemployment fell in October to recent cyclical lows, but the good news won’t continue.
  • Mexico’s job market remains resilient, buoying Banxico’s hawks, but the current strength can’t last.
  • In Chile and Colombia, the job market also looks solid, but this is a lagging indicator; it will slow soon.
